How they compare
Serbia currently reports 14.08 years against 13.63 years in MDG: Western Asia, a difference of 0.45 years.
Across all 22 years both countries report, Serbia has been ahead every year.
MDG: Western Asia ranks 79th and Serbia ranks 76th of 221 groups.
Serbia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| MDG: Western Asia | Serbia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 11.74 years | 12.94 years | 1.21 years | Serbia |
| 2010s | 12.72 years | 13.98 years | 1.26 years | Serbia |
| 2020s | 13.48 years | 13.83 years | 0.3553 years | Serbia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
